Technical and environmental efficiency of agriculture sector in South Asia: a stochastic frontier analysis approach
Environment, Development and Sustainability ( IF 4.7 ) Pub Date : 2020-10-10 , DOI: 10.1007/s10668-020-01023-2
Zainab Bibi , Dilawar Khan , Ihtisham ul Haq

The purpose of this study was to measure and assess comparative study of technical and environmental efficiency of agriculture sector in South Asia using balanced panel data for the period 2002–2016. The translog stochastic frontier analysis approach was applied to estimate output-oriented technical efficiency and input-oriented environmental efficiency. Results of translog production model give that output elasticity w.r.t. land, labor, capital and fertilizer is 2.13, 1.26, 0.01 and 0.17, respectively. Log likelihood test shows that there is technical inefficiency in the agriculture sector of South Asian countries. The average value of output-oriented technical efficiency for South Asian countries was 0.92 ranging from 0.82 to 0.97. This suggests that agricultural production of South Asian region could be increased up to 8 percent by eliminating the effects of technical inefficiency. Moreover, the findings show that Sri Lanka is the most technically efficient country having efficiency 0.99 followed by India (0.98), Bhutan (0.93), Bangladesh (0.89), Nepal (0.88) and Pakistan (0.85). The results of input-oriented environmental efficiency score of South Asia were 0.77 ranging from 0.57 to 0.97. This shows that there is opportunity to enhance environmental efficiency of South Asian countries by 23%. Sri Lanka achieved the highest environmental efficiency (0.97) followed by India (0.96), Bhutan (0.72), Bangladesh (0.71), Pakistan (0.67) and Nepal (0.57). It is recommended that there must be collaboration among the South Asian countries in research and development especially in agriculture sector on priority bases.

南亚农业部门的技术和环境效率:随机前沿分析方法

本研究的目的是使用 2002-2016 年期间的平衡面板数据衡量和评估南亚农业部门技术和环境效率的比较研究。应用跨对数随机前沿分析方法估计面向产出的技术效率和面向投入的环境效率。Translog 生产模型的结果表明,土地、劳动力、资本和肥料的产出弹性分别为 2.13、1.26、0.01 和 0.17。对数似然检验表明,南亚国家农业部门存在技术效率低下的问题。南亚国家以产出为导向的技术效率平均值为 0.92,介于 0.82 至 0.97 之间。这表明,通过消除技术效率低下的影响,南亚地区的农业产量可以提高 8%。此外,调查结果显示,斯里兰卡是技术效率最高的国家,效率为 0.99,其次是印度 (0.98)、不丹 (0.93)、孟加拉国 (0.89)、尼泊尔 (0.88) 和巴基斯坦 (0.85)。南亚投入导向的环境效率得分为0.77,范围从0.57到0.97。这表明南亚国家的环境效率有机会提高 23%。斯里兰卡的环境效率最高(0.97),其次是印度(0.96)、不丹(0.72)、孟加拉国(0.71)、巴基斯坦(0.67)和尼泊尔(0.57)。
